I've been wondering, would it be possible to run debian
mipsel  
packages on the hpcmips port if it had a linux emulation
layer? It  
would give us access to a lot of prebuilt packages. Also
does the  
hpcmips port not have a linux emulation because from what I
found  
from searching around it doesn't seem to, but I just want to
get this  
confirmed.

  There is mips support in linux compat code under
src/sys/compat/arch/mips.  I tried building a kernel with
"options
COMPAT_LINUX" and it needed a few changes to build, so
apparently it is
not used much and comments indicate that it is incomplete. 
There is quite
a bit of common code so it might work for some binaries. 
Patch attached
below and at: http://www.city-net.com/~darkstar/netbsd/mipslinux.diff
